Law & Order: Special Victims Unit Season 14 Episode 7
When a woman claims that the baby she kidnapped is hers with a respected legal expert, the investigation changes the lives of two families.
Views: 3
Episode Title: Vanity's Bonfire
Air Date: 2012-11-14
